Carnival Corporation (NYSE:CCL - Get Free Report) Director Sir Jonathon Band sold 12,500 shares of the company's st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, August 5th. The shares were sold at an average price of $29.75, for a total transaction of $371,875.00. Following the sale, the director directly owned 64,406 shares of the company's stock, valued at $1,916,078.50. This represents a 16.25% decrease in their ownership of the stock. Carnival (NYSE:CCL -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Tuesday, June 24th. The company reported $0.35 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.24 by $0.11. The business had revenue of $6.33 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$6.20 billion. Carnival had a net margin of 9.72% and a return on equity of 27.88%. The firm's revenue for the quarter was up 9.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m posted $0.11 earnings per share. On average, research analysts predict that Carnival Corporation will post 1.77 earnings per share for the current year.

Carnival Corp. engages in the operation of cruise ships. It operates through the following business segments: North America and Australia (NAA) Cruise, Europe and Asia (EA) Cruise Operations, Cruise Support, and Tour and Others. The North America and Australia (NAA) Cruise segment includes the Carnival Cruise Line, Holland America Line, Princess Cruises, and Seabourn.
